Queens-Magnolia Terrace, located between Belhaven and Fondren, is a historic and residential Jackson neighborhood with tree-lined streets and early-20th-century architecture. The neighborhood’s character concentrates around the North State Street corridor near Eudora Welty House & Garden, where porch-front homes meet a calm, walk-and-look streetscape. Brick cottages and larger revival-style houses sit behind deep lawns and mature magnolias, giving blocks a measured, lived-in rhythm. Weekend culture often points toward nearby galleries, small stages, and local dining rather than big-box corridors. Commuter routes run straight into Downtown, while side streets stay quiet and shaded.

The purpose of this district is to protect single-family uses by permitting development on lot sizes not less than 10,000 sq ft. All other provisions of the R-1 Residential District shall be applied with the exception of the R-1 minimum lot size.
